Skip to main content

Documentation Index

Fetch the complete documentation index at: https://docs.endorlabs.com/llms.txt

Use this file to discover all available pages before exploring further.

Open source software comes with different licenses that define how the software can be used, modified, and distributed. Managing license compliance is essential for organizations to avoid legal risks and ensure proper use of open source components. For generating Notice reports for distribution and for license-centric views and editable license data, see Licenses.

Policy templates for open source license detection

Endor Labs provides the following policy templates for detecting open source license usage. See Finding policies for details on how to create policies from policy templates.

License types

Endor Labs classifies licenses according to industry best practices:
  • Restricted: Licenses with significant usage restrictions.
  • Reciprocal: Licenses that require derivative works or linked code to be shared under compatible terms.
  • Copyleft: Licenses that require derivative works to use the same license.
  • Notice: Licenses that require attribution or notice when distributing the software.
  • Permissive: Licenses that allow broad use with minimal restrictions.
  • Unencumbered: Licenses that dedicate the work to the public domain or grant very broad rights with no material conditions.
  • Forbidden: Licenses that should not be used in your organization.